About

J Scott Clark is a business attorney with more than 37 years of legal experience, practicing at Law Offices of J Scott Clark in Fennville, MI. He attended Ohio State University - Moritz College of Law and Ohio State University. He is admitted to practice in Ohio (since 1989) and Tennessee (since 1988). His practice encompasses business, estate planning, and real estate,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
